Sodium Laureth Sulfate (SLES), also known as sodium alkyl ether sulfate (AES), is a versatile anionic surfactant with the chemical formula CH₃(CH₂)₁₁(OCH₂CH₂)ₙOSO₃Na (n=1–4, typically 3). Derived from renewable palm kernel or coconut oil, it is produced via ethoxylation of lauryl alcohol, followed by sulfation and neutralization. Renowned for its balanced performance, mildness, and cost-effectiveness, SLES is a foundational ingredient in personal care, household cleaning, and industrial formulations—outperforming sodium lauryl sulfate (SLS) in gentleness while maintaining strong detergency and foaming.
Commercially available as a pale yellow viscous liquid (28% or 70% active concentrations) or powder, SLES boasts key properties: high water solubility, effective surface tension reduction, stable foam across pH 7.0–9.0, hard water stability, and easy thickening with sodium chloride. It is readily biodegradable in wastewater systems, minimizing environmental impact.
SLES dominates rinse-off personal care, including shampoos, body washes, facial cleansers, and baby care products—delivering gentle cleansing without excessive drying. In household cleaning, it powers liquid dish detergents, laundry detergents, and all-purpose cleaners, cutting grease and suspending soils effectively. Industrial applications include textile scouring, leather degreasing, and petrochemical drilling additives.
Its core advantages include mildness (lower irritation than SLS), cost-efficiency, formulation flexibility (compatible with most surfactants), and global regulatory compliance (FDA, EU SCCS approved). Purified SLES (1,4-dioxane <10 ppm) is safe for normal use, with low acute toxicity and minimal environmental risk when properly handled.
